What a Fast Little Engine!, sometimes referred to as What a Fast Little Engine!: Scenes from 'Choo-Choo', was commissioned by Box Not Found for their Stories concert series. The music retells the story of Virginia Lee Burton's 1930's children's book Choo-Choo: The Story of a Little Engine Who Ran Away through music. As an added bonus for the audience, many of the illustrations from the book, drawn in black-and-white by Burton herself, are presented in a coordinated slideshow; this pairing directly connects the music to the images and actions in the book.
